Transaction 75e2246bffc39ae7c85fdc40684807dfad8f8d577e103363a11681bc9d083f9a

1 Input
2 Outputs
  • 75e2246bffc39ae7c85fdc40684807dfad8f8d577e103363a11681bc9d083f9a:0
  • value  3098331
    address  1EgqQzVKCrWDni4VUFgBQ2TU9Bef9hS42C
  • 75e2246bffc39ae7c85fdc40684807dfad8f8d577e103363a11681bc9d083f9a:1
  • value  9069098
    address  bc1q57j3j3v7qq0gcgglkycj4agd0p6ahpvphx7sju